"If Ben-Gurion pushes for a civil war, he will get one" – a rare poster by the Etzel (Irgun) organization threatening a response by fire against members of the Haganah who attack its men
"An end to the rioters’ rampage" – "We are not subdued by fire nor by death" – an especially forceful poster by the Etzel (Irgun) organization, issued in response to armed attacks carried out against its members while they were posting propaganda notices. The poster threatens: "We will return fire for fire." Cheshvan 5708- October–November 1947.

The poster details serious incidents in which Etzel members, who came to post notices in the moshavot and in the south, were attacked by “rioters” from the Haganah organization in Tel Aviv, Bat Yam, and other locations, and it warns:
"We do not want altercations with the Haganah, but under no circumstances will we allow sabotage of our organization, silencing of our voice, or abuse of our members. We will respond to every abuse and assault. And we will return fire for fire. We hereby declare and warn: we do not want a civil war. But it is becoming increasingly clear that Ben-Gurion is pushing for a civil war, he will get one. We are not frightened by threats. We are not subdued by fire nor by death. No man has yet been born who can break the spirit of the brother of Dov Gruner, the National Military Organization in the Land of Israel. Cheshvan 5708 (1947)."
During the War of Independence, tensions and clashes between the Etzel and Lehi continued, despite both acting in the name of the struggle for independence. Open confrontations took place in Jerusalem, including friction over control of neighborhoods and weapons acquisition routes, and there were even reports of mutual kidnappings or arrests among activists. These struggles reflected a deeper tension over shaping the identity of the emerging state between an evolving political establishment and revolutionary Revisionist factions.
35x26 cm. Fold mark. Minor edge tears. Good condition.
